IDataMaskingOperations Interface

Definition

Represents all the operations for operating on Azure SQL Database data masking. Contains operations to: Create, Retrieve, Update, and Delete data masking rules, as well as Create, Retreive and Update data masking policy.

public interface IDataMaskingOperations
type IDataMaskingOperations = interface
Public Interface IDataMaskingOperations

Methods

CreateOrUpdatePolicyAsync(String, String, String, DataMaskingPolicyCreateOrUpdateParameters, CancellationToken)

Creates or updates an Azure SQL Database data masking policy

CreateOrUpdateRuleAsync(String, String, String, String, DataMaskingRuleCreateOrUpdateParameters, CancellationToken)

Creates or updates an Azure SQL Database Server Firewall rule.

DeleteAsync(String, String, String, String, CancellationToken)

Deletes an Azure SQL Server data masking rule.

GetPolicyAsync(String, String, String, CancellationToken)

Returns an Azure SQL Database data masking policy.

ListAsync(String, String, String, CancellationToken)

Returns a list of Azure SQL Database data masking rules.

Extension Methods

CreateOrUpdatePolicy(IDataMaskingOperations, String, String, String, DataMaskingPolicyCreateOrUpdateParameters)

Creates or updates an Azure SQL Database data masking policy

CreateOrUpdatePolicyAsync(IDataMaskingOperations, String, String, String, DataMaskingPolicyCreateOrUpdateParameters)

Creates or updates an Azure SQL Database data masking policy

CreateOrUpdateRule(IDataMaskingOperations, String, String, String, String, DataMaskingRuleCreateOrUpdateParameters)

Creates or updates an Azure SQL Database Server Firewall rule.

CreateOrUpdateRuleAsync(IDataMaskingOperations, String, String, String, String, DataMaskingRuleCreateOrUpdateParameters)

Creates or updates an Azure SQL Database Server Firewall rule.

Delete(IDataMaskingOperations, String, String, String, String)

Deletes an Azure SQL Server data masking rule.

DeleteAsync(IDataMaskingOperations, String, String, String, String)

Deletes an Azure SQL Server data masking rule.

GetPolicy(IDataMaskingOperations, String, String, String)

Returns an Azure SQL Database data masking policy.

GetPolicyAsync(IDataMaskingOperations, String, String, String)

Returns an Azure SQL Database data masking policy.

List(IDataMaskingOperations, String, String, String)

Returns a list of Azure SQL Database data masking rules.

ListAsync(IDataMaskingOperations, String, String, String)

Returns a list of Azure SQL Database data masking rules.

Applies to